既然要用 YAML 配置文件部署應用,現在就很有必要了解一下 Deployment 的配置格式,其他 Controller(比如 DaemonSet)非常類似。 還是以 nginx-deployment 為例,配置文件如下圖所示: ① apiVersion 是當前配置格式的版本 ...
既然要用 YAML 配置文件部署應用,現在就很有必要了解一下 Deployment 的配置格式,其他 Controller 比如 DaemonSet 非常類似。 還是以 nginx deployment 為例,配置文件如下圖所示: apiVersion是當前配置格式的版本。 kind是要創建的資源類型,這里是Deployment。 metadata是該資源的元數據,name是必需的元數據項。 sp ...
2019-06-25 15:08 0 1074 推薦指數:
既然要用 YAML 配置文件部署應用,現在就很有必要了解一下 Deployment 的配置格式,其他 Controller(比如 DaemonSet)非常類似。 還是以 nginx-deployment 為例,配置文件如下圖所示: ① apiVersion 是當前配置格式的版本 ...
yaml文件相關字段的記錄,臨時記錄,有些亂,請諒解 ...
Deployment 簡述 Deployment 為 Pod 和 ReplicaSet 提供了一個聲明式定義 (declarative) 方法,用來替代以前的 ReplicationController 更方便的管理應用。 作為最常用的 Kubernetes 對象,Deployment 經常會 ...
使用示例 1. 使用args參數 2. 使用command 3. 說明 ...
YAML語言似乎已經成為了事實標准的“雲配置”語言,無論是容器事實標准docker(主要是docker-compose使用)、SDN,還是容器編排王者kubernetes,又或是虛擬機時代的王者openstack采用的配置文件都是yaml文件格式。不過需要承認的是我個人最初剛接觸yaml時 ...
#kubectl get deployment ##獲取deployment名稱 #kubectl scale deployment nginx-deployment --replicas=3 擴容到3個 #kubectl scale ...
運行一個deployment: kubectl run nginx-deployment --image=nginx:1.7.9 --replicas=2 基本例子: nginx-test.yaml apiVersion: extensions/v1beta1 #當前 ...
從本章開始,我們將通過實踐深入學習 Kubernetes 的各種特性。作為容器編排引擎,最重要也是最基本的功能當然是運行容器化應用,這就是本章的內容。 Deployment 前面我們已經了解到,Kubernetes 通過各種 Controller 來管理 Pod 的生命周期。為了滿足不同業 ...